Singapore Backs Rules-Based Trade Despite Short-Term Pain, BT Reports
Singapore will stick to its rules-based trade principles even if it comes at a short-term cost, the Business Times reported Wednesday, citing the country’s Deputy Prime Minister Gan Kim Yong.
“This is important for us as a hub economy. We have to be a trusted partner… No one will send their goods through Singapore if they do not trust us,” Gan said in response to a question on how Singapore assessed the US as a long-term strategic and economic partner.
